Notes and References

The ranking above is published by College Factual, 2026 edition. Schools are ranked on the median early-career earnings of their finance financial management graduates, drawn primarily from the U.S. Department of Education (College Scorecard field-of-study earnings and IPEDS).

Ranking method: College Major Earnings · 51 schools evaluated.

*Salary figures reflect median early-career earnings (about 5 years after graduation) and may vary by how long a person takes to complete their degree.
